Output ff4a04eddd5763f2bbadf0527f679da4bcbba98cdbf7b623dfbe40b9dca4017b:2

value
26500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f4e8972a3d566c8a14fc2f3723cd0e92d40923 OP_EQUAL
address
3JjYzmZKQ2m35yhk9S5Jg9hwSytMzunr1h
transaction
ff4a04eddd5763f2bbadf0527f679da4bcbba98cdbf7b623dfbe40b9dca4017b
confirmations
363352
spent
true